Three people have been arrested as part of an investigation into the supply of drugs in East Lancashire.

This morning, (September 12) police arrested another three people as part of that investigation.

A woman, aged 27, from Rossendale, was arrested on suspicion of supplying controlled drugs.

A woman, aged 36, from Bacup, was arrested on suspicion of possession with intent to supply class A drugs.

A man, aged 57, from Bacup, was arrested in Nelson on suspicion of possession with intent to supply drugs other than class A. They are all in custody.

DCI John Roy, of East CID, said: “I want once again to thank the community for their continued support, and I hope that seeing these results both reassures them that we will take action and encourages them to continue to report suspicious activity, either directly to the police or anonymously to Crimestoppers.
